Abstract
In a general aspect, a method is presented for determining a motion-zone confidence. In some aspects, the method includes obtaining, from a database of a motion detection system, ranges of motion-zone parameters associated with respective motion zones in a space between wireless communication devices. The method also includes analyzing the ranges of motion-zone parameters to identify, for one or more of the motion zones, overlapping ranges of motion-zone parameters and non-overlapping parameter ranges of motion-zone parameters. The method additionally includes storing, in the database of the motion detection system, the overlapping and non-overlapping ranges of motion-zone parameters. The overlapping and non-overlapping ranges of motion-zone parameters are used to identify one of the motion zones based on a motion event detected by the motion detection system.
